Registrations Open for the AWS re/Start Program, with Free Classes and Certification in Technology. Learn How to Participate.
If you have always wanted to start a career in technology, this is your chance! Senac RJ, in partnership with Amazon Web Services (AWS), is offering 25 spots for a free cloud computing course.
The program, called AWS re/Start, aims to prepare professionals for entry-level roles in the cloud field, covering everything from technical concepts to interview preparation and resume writing.
The classes will start on December 16, 2024 and will be held remotely, ensuring more accessibility for participants.

The course is free and, at the end, students will receive a certificate, a significant advantage for those looking to enter or advance in the technology market.
Unique Opportunity in the Cloud Field
The course is part of AWS’s global project, which seeks to empower individuals with little or no experience in technology.
During the program, participants will learn fundamental concepts of cloud computing, such as Linux, Python, networking, security, and automation, as well as explore the AWS ecosystem.
Classes will be held Monday to Friday, from 6 PM to 10 PM, in a remote format. This makes it easier for those who work or study during the day to participate.
In addition to technical content, students will have career development workshops, including interview simulations and resume writing, to ensure they are ready to secure jobs in the IT field.
Courses Available in the Program
Check out the main topics that will be covered:
- Linux: Essential operating system for cloud infrastructure and servers.
- Python: Programming language widely used in automation and data science.
- Networking: Fundamentals of computer networks and their application in the cloud.
- AWS Cloud: Key services and resources offered by Amazon Web Services.
- Security: Best practices for protecting data and infrastructure in the cloud.
- Database and Automation: Fundamental techniques for managing information and automating processes.
Simplified Selection Process
The selection process consists of four steps:
- Registration: Done on the Senac RJ website.
- Logic Test: Basic assessment to measure logical reasoning.
- Basic Computer Skills: Demonstrate simple knowledge in technology.
- Individual Interview: Final assessment to identify candidates with the best profile for the course.
To participate, it is necessary to:
- Be 18 years or older;
- Have completed high school;
- Prove a per capita income of up to two minimum wages, meeting Senac’s gratuitous criteria.
Selected candidates will have access to a high-level course, with content that prepares them to work as cloud analysts in technology companies.
How to Enroll?
Registrations must be made exclusively through the official Senac RJ website, accessing the relationship page (relacionamento.rj.senac.br). On the portal, you need to fill in the required fields, provide the requested information, and click on “Finish” to complete the process.
